Hola amigos, tengo un problema entre estos 2 dispostivos el mpu9150 y el rtc ds1207 puesto que los 2 tienen una misma id y si los llego a conectar a mi arduino mega a la vez, me envian datos erroneos. aunque si se conecta solo 1 si funcionan normalmente??
a alguien le a pasado, alguna solucion o idea??
gracias de antemano
todos los dispositivos I2C tienen una o varias direcciónes que puedes cambiar.
MPU9150 tiene por defecto
AD0 = 0 con dirección 1101000 = 0x68
AD0 = 1 con dirección 1101001 = 0x69
y el RTC tiene dirección 0x68 pero no vi como cambiarla, aunque recuerdo que es posible.
Asi que dejemos al RTC como está y ya que AD0 esta disponible en el MPU9150, conecta AD0 a la alimentación del MPU que supongo serán 3.3V para que este a nivel 1 y por lo tanto tenga dirección 0x69.
gracias surbyte, estuve mirando la hoja de datos y dice -05v del voltaje (vdd) + 5v del cual es hasta 6 volts
eso quiere decir que por la pata A0 me deberia aguantar 5 v, pero si la pongo a ese voltaje se me apaga el arduino (entra en corto) y si la conecto a 3.3 igual sigue saliendo mal los datos si los 2 sensores, estan conectados, entonces..... nose que he hecho mal